Viardi designed the collection to pay tribute to the women that the castle once served as home to, including Catherine deâ Medici and Diane de Poitiers. With both influences from the Renaissance and modern culture weaved throughout the collection, the show, overall, was a hit with virtual viewers from within the fashion community.  âShowing at the Château de Chenonceau, at the âChâteau des Damesâ, was an obvious choice. It was designed and lived in by women, including Diane de Poitiers and Catherine deâ Medici. It is a castle on a human scale.
